Grown-ups develop to around 6 feet (1.8 m) long. They have exceptionally created front teeth that are likely proportionately bigger than those of some other non-venomous snake.

The shading design normally comprises an emerald green ground shading with a white unpredictable intruded on crisscross stripe or alleged 'lightning jolts' down the back and a yellow paunch. The splendid hue and markings are extremely particular among South American snakes. Adolescents change in shading between different shades of light and dim orange or block red before ontogenetic hue sets in and the creatures turn emerald green (following 9– a year of age). This additionally happens in green tree python (Morelia viridis), a python species in which hatchlings and adolescents may likewise be canary yellow or block red. Instead of mainstream thinking, yellow adolescents (as in the green tree python) don't happen in the emerald tree boa.
